We don't put kibble in our squirrel buddy, as my two girls will fight to the death over it. I do, however, put some peanut butter inside the opening each morning when I leave for work. Keeps them busy for a good little while. The squirrel buddy is stronger than Kong -- my mild-mannered, but very persistent 60 pound Weimaraner destroyed two Kongs -- one regular and one heavy-duty. She hasn't managed to chew up the squirrel. Other toys from the same company haven't fared as well against her, but the squirrel continues to survive my ferocious chewers. Ordering three more!
